在Web开发中,表单是收集用户输入数据的重要工具。使用jQuery,我们可以轻松地实现点击按钮自动提交表单的功能,从而提升用户体验和开发效率。下面,我将详细讲解如何使用jQuery实现这一功能。
准备工作
在开始之前,请确保你的项目中已经引入了jQuery库。以下是一个简单的引入方式:
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.6.0/jquery.min.js"></script>
选择器
首先,我们需要为要提交的表单和提交按钮分别设置一个ID或类名,以便在jQuery中选择它们。
<form id="myForm">
<input type="text" name="username" placeholder="请输入用户名">
<input type="password" name="password" placeholder="请输入密码">
<button type="button" id="submitBtn">提交</button>
</form>
编写jQuery代码
接下来,我们编写jQuery代码来实现点击按钮自动提交表单的功能。
$(document).ready(function() {
$('#submitBtn').click(function() {
$('#myForm').submit();
});
});
这段代码中,我们使用了$(document).ready()函数来确保DOM元素加载完成后再执行代码。然后,我们为ID为submitBtn的按钮绑定了一个点击事件,当按钮被点击时,会触发$('#myForm').submit();这行代码,从而提交表单。
测试
现在,你可以将这段代码添加到你的项目中,并测试点击按钮是否能够自动提交表单。如果一切正常,点击按钮后,表单数据将被发送到服务器。
总结
使用jQuery实现点击按钮自动提交表单非常简单,只需为按钮绑定一个点击事件,并在事件处理函数中调用表单的submit()方法即可。这种方法不仅可以提高用户体验,还可以节省开发时间。希望这篇文章能帮助你轻松掌握这一技能。
